Rudimental ‘Waiting All Night’ by Nez

For Rudimental’s Waiting All Night, Nez and producer Elliott Tagg travelled to LA to reconstruct, in the form of a mini drama-documentary, the inspirational story of Kurt Yeager, a top BMX pro rider who came back against all the odds to compete again after suffering a terrible injury. Phoenix ‘Entertainment’ by Patrick Daughters

The band are French, the director is American (now based in Paris) – and the video is Korean. Samuel J Bailey joins Riff Raff Films’ Nursery Of Evil

Samuel J Bailey, director of acclaimed videos for Francobollo and festival favourite short film The Horsemen, has joined Riff Raff Films for music videos and commercials, entering the company’s stable of up-and-coming directors, The Nursery Of Evil. Amplify Dot ‘Get Down’ by The Sacred Egg

The Sacred Egg deliver this unique ‘eye control’ promo for Amplify Dot’s Get Down, where the artist’s eye movement controls the angle of the shot.
